tombstone
Portrait of a Woman Near a Balustrade, 1804. Jean-Baptiste Jacques Augustin (French, 1759–1832). Watercolor on ivory on a gilt metal mount in an ebonized frame; framed: 14.2 x 13.8 cm (5 9/16 x 5 7/16 in.); unframed: 8.8 x 8.5 cm (3 7/16 x 3 3/8 in.). The Cleveland Museum of Art, Gift of J. H. Wade Jr., G. G. Wade and Mrs. E. B. Greene, 1926.235
